Prince of Death’s Pustule Talisman question by mindsoarer in Eldenring

[–]djowatts 4 points5 points  (0 children)

Vitality is definitely a stat. Not one of the main ones you level up, but it's on the stat screen and you can get a description of what it does there.

Death is a status effect that accumulates like poison, rot or madness. When the bar fills up, you instantly die. This makes that bar go up slower.

We walk sideways in backwards circles, can we please get an option to just strafe normally? by Ev1dentFir3 in Eldenring

[–]djowatts 0 points1 point  (0 children)

I believe this is only when you are locked on. If you unlock target, you should be able to move more naturally.

The same happens with dodges. When locked on, you can only dodge forward, backward left or right, but when unlocked you have a full 360 degrees of choice for dodge direction

[deleted by user] by [deleted] in Eldenring

[–]djowatts 1 point2 points  (0 children)

Rahdan is harder if you summon another player as you can't use Torrent when someone is summoned in.

A tip for you though,

While his big boulders are up, run around focusing on re summoning the NPC summons who have died, and use the big hill as cover from the boulders until they are gone, then hit and run him while he's distracted by NPCs
